#2cc912 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2cc912 is composed of 17.3% red, 78.8%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 91%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 111.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 42.9%. #2cc912 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ff24 with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#2cc912 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2cc912 has RGB values of R:44, G:201,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 2935058.

Shades and Tints of #2cc912

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f2fef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2cc912

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#687566 is the less saturated color, while #20da01 is the most saturated one.
